Transaction
eea32c167694c3b16c8ecefa3e79a59a86cf7c3688f74a154272450ad1190bfa
Confirmed1,827,229 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- eea32c167694c3b16c8ecefa3e79a59a86cf7c3688f74a154272450ad1190bfa
- Block
- #666,003
- Timestamp
- 5/7/2017, 10:28:53 PM3333 days ago
- Confirmations
- 1,827,229
- Total Input
- 19.01170872
- Total Output
- 19.01095552
- Fee
- 0.00075320
- Size
- 3,765 bytes
Value distribution
Fee 0.00075320- Xe1Yed…MRgDqt 0.06%
- XdTUBd…q6uinG 99.9%
- Fee 0.00%
Total Input19.01170872
Total Output19.01095552
Network Fee0.00075320